Cab Fare Information

Below is a listing of how taxicab fares are determined and paid in the City of Chicago as of May 11, 2005:

  • In Chicago, you pay the amount shown on the taximeter, plus any tolls,
  • There is no extra charge for baggage or credit card use, and tipping is optional,
  • The ¡°flag pull¡± or initial charge is $2.25 for the first 1/9 mile,
  • The additional fraction of a mile charge is $.20 for each additional 1/9 mile,
  • Every 36 seconds of time elapsed is $.20,
  • The flat fee for the first additional passenger is $1.00,
  • The flat fee for each additional passenger, after the first additional passenger is $.50.

Average Fares

These are average fares from State and Madison Streets to various destinations. Fares will vary, depending on traffic conditions:

  • State and Madison to O¡¯Hare: $30 - $35.
  • State and Madison to Midway: $22 - $28.
  • State and Madison to the United Center: $8 - $10.

Metered Fares

Straight meter fares
- fares with no special rates - apply to trips from Midway or O'Hare airports to the following suburbs. *All other trips are metered at one and one half the rate from Chicago's city limits to the suburbs.

  • Alsip
  • Bedford Park
  • Blue Island
  • Burnham
  • Calumet City
  • Calumet Park
  • Cicero
  • Des Plaines
  • Dolton
  • Elk Grove
  • Elmwood Park
  • Evanston
  • Evergreen Park
  • Forest View
  • Harwood Heights
  • Hines Hospital
  • Hometown
  • Lincolnwood
  • Merrionette Park
  • Niles
  • Norridge
  • Oak Lawn
  • Oak Park
  • Park Ridge
  • Riverdale
  • River Grove
  • Rosemont
  • Stickney
  • Summit

Rates from O'Hare or Midway to all other suburbs are meter and one-half. Rates from Chicago, excluding O'Hare and Midway Airports, are straight meter to the city limits plus meter and one-half from the city limits to the destination.

An additional charge of $1.00 is added to the total fare on each trip to or from O'Hare or Midway Airports under the State of Illinois Metropolitan Pier & Exposition Authority (MPEA) Airport Departure Ordinance. The tax should appear on the meter as an "extra" charge.
